Analysis

The most recent figure for school age population, tertiary education, both sexes in Cote d'Ivoire is 2.33 million number, measured in 2017. That is the highest value across all 48 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 3.1% on the previous year and up 34.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, school age population, tertiary education, both sexes in Cote d'Ivoire peaked at 2.33 million number in 2017 and was at its lowest, 372,130 number, in 1970.

Cote d'Ivoire ranks 47th of 203 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 48 years of available data.
